Description

The 5th Australian edition Kozier & Erb's Fundamentals of Nursing continues to setting the foundation for nursing excellence amid ongoing changes to the regulation of nursing. For undergraduate nurses, the product covers key concepts in contemporary nursing such as delivering inclusive nursing practice, as well as discussing the latest nursing evidence, standards, and competencies. Aligned with current nursing standards, the 5th edition helps students link their theoretical knowledge to clinical practice. New to this edition Updated Research Notes, Real World features and images to reflect contemporary Australian and New Zealand research, clinician stories and evidence-based practice. Updated to include recent changes to the NSQHS standards, including: Comprehensive care Communication for safety mental health and cognitive impairment health literacy, end-of-life care and,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ander health. The Patient Safety Competency Framework (PSCF) for Nursing Students are integrated throughout the chapters, with practical examples on how the safety domains can be applied in practice. Addition of a new chapter focused on Disability, allowing for a more thorough understanding of disability and how it is related to different topics of nursing The Fundamentals of Care Framework is integrated throughout, showing how each of the three dimensions can be applied to nursing practice by way of application to case study questions throughout the text. Learning outcomes and examples are mapped to the relevant Nursing and Midwifery Board of Australia (NMBA) Registered Nurse Standards for Practice and Patent Safety Competency Framework document.
